ZIP code 35744 is located in Dutton, Alabama, within Jackson County. With a population of 2,315, this is a sparsely populated ZIP code with a middle-aged community — the median age is 43.4 years. Economically, 35744 is a working-class ZIP code: the median household income of $51,761 is below the national average.
Real estate in ZIP code 35744 represents an affordable housing market. The median home value of $170,000 is below the national average. Renters can expect to pay around $789 per month in median rent. Homeownership is strong here — 72.8% of occupied units are owner-occupied, suggesting an established, stable residential community. Median home values have increased by 44% since 2019.
The population of 35744 is primarily White (88.77%). Residents are less-educated — 21.7% hold a bachelor's degree or higher, which is below the national average. Poverty affects some residents at 11.7%. Household income has grown by 41% since 2019.
The unemployment rate in 35744 stands at 4.5%, which is near the national average. As in most parts of the country, driving alone is the dominant commute mode at 82%.
Overall, ZIP code 35744 in Dutton, AL is characterized as working-class, less-educated, a middle-aged community, and predominantly owner-occupied.
